抗氧剂2246单丙酸酯的合成及表征  被引量:1

Synthesis and characterization of antioxidant 2246 mono propionate

摘  要:以抗氧剂2246和丙酰氯为原料、三乙胺为缚酸剂进行单酚羟基酯化反应,合成了抗氧剂2246单丙酸酯,确定了最佳合成工艺条件,并通过液相色谱、傅里叶变换红外光谱及核磁共振氢谱对产物进行了表征。结果表明,最佳合成工艺条件为抗氧剂2246/丙酰氯/三乙胺(摩尔比)1∶1.2∶1.8、抗氧剂2246/石油醚(质量比)1∶3.3、于60℃滴加丙酰氯、反应温度80℃、保温反应5.0 h;此条件下反应具有较好的重复稳定性,产品最高收率达到88.51%,纯度为98.5%,熔点104~106℃。The 2-(2-hydroxy-5-methyl-3-tert-butyl-benzyl)-4-methyl-6-tert-butyl-phenyl propionate(antioxidant 2246 mono propionate) was synthesized by mono phenolic hydroxyl esterification reaction with antioxidant 2246 and propionyl chloride as raw materials,triethylamine as acid binding agent,the optimal reaction conditions were found,and the obtained product was characterized by liquid chromatography,Fourier transform infrared spectroscopy and 1H-nuclear magnetic resonance.The results showed that the optimal reaction conditions were as follows: n(antioxidant 2246)/n(propionyl chloride)/n(triethylamine) 1∶ 1.2∶ 1.8,mass ratio of antioxidant 2246 to petroleum ether 1∶ 3.3,temperature for dripfeeding propionyl chloride 60 ℃,reation temperature 80 ℃ and reaction time 5.0 h.Under these conditions,the maximum yield,purity and melting point of the product reached 88.51%,98.5% and 104-106 ℃ respectively,and the reaction had good repeatability and stability.
